How to Become a Better Poker Player

poker

Poker is a fascinating game because it offers a window into human nature. It’s also a game that can be very profitable, but only if you know how to play it well.

It’s important to learn how to read players at the poker table. This skill is called body language and consists of reading facial expressions, eye movements and other tells. In addition, you should pay attention to how people handle their chips and cards.

Another crucial skill to master is knowing when to call and fold. When you have a strong hand, it is usually worth calling. However, if you have a weak one, it’s better to fold. This will prevent you from throwing good money after bad.

Similarly, it’s also important to know when to bluff. You should only bluff when you have a decent chance of winning the pot. Otherwise, you’ll just waste your money.

It is also helpful to memorize the rankings of hands. For example, you should know that a flush beats a straight and that three of a kind beats two pair. This will help you make sound decisions and win more often.

The best way to become a great poker player is to practice as much as possible. Try to spend at least an hour every day playing poker and be sure to take notes on your progress. You should also study poker books and watch videos from famous professional players. Additionally, you can join a poker forum and interact with other players to improve your skills.
